The assessor, tax collector, and auditor shall, except where specifically prohibited by law, charge and collect a fee of one dollar ($1) for preparing each of the following documents: (a) A certified copy of a redemption certificate. (b) A certified copy of an installment redemption receipt. (c) A certified copy of an assessment as entered on the assessment roll. The fee for providing a copy of a record or document by photographic process shall be the actual cost thereof plus the sum of one dollar ($1). The fee shall be placed in the county general fund.
